Decluttering Techniques

Focus on one location at a time, such as your nightstand or closet. Remove anything that isn’t a necessity or that you don’t absolutely love; donate or trash the rest. With nothing to distract the senses, a minimalist bedroom provides an airiness and stillness that can be the end to a long day.
Incorporating Greenery

Including an extra plant in your room brings newness which makes it vibrant. The space can be uplifted without going through changes because of a few greenery pieces in strategic areas. Additionally, it would clean the air, which would in return make your simple sanctuary feel even more inviting.
Neutral Color Palettes

Using neutral color tones will automatically create a calm and welcoming atmosphere in your bedroom. There is nothing more relaxing than the perfect light colors like soft whites, muted beige, and light grays. The core of this minimalist style will have natural textures and materials as its pillar, thus creating a cozy and warm room.

Layered Lighting Solutions

And here is where the beauty of layered lighting (i.e. the magic) comes in: Consider mixing between ceiling fixtures, wall sconces, and tabletop lamps for depth and interest. This way it’s simple to modify the ambience whether you need bright gentle for reading or soft gentle for resting.
Smart Storage Solutions

An intelligent storage idea combines well at a minimalist bedroom due to the fact it prevents clutter. Put your books and beautiful surfaces on floating shelves but rein in the essentials in drawers. A clean design not only has a great visual appeal but can also add open atmosphere to a space.
Personal Touches with Minimalism

It can be minimal, yet cozy and personal. Only a few specific items, a couple of framed photos, or a one vase can add personality to the place without being overbearing. Keep that color palette soft and neutral to maintain the laid back vibe and make it your own.

Open Space Concept

An open space concept can create a spacious feel towards your bedroom and make it more welcoming. Less furniture is best to be able to move without obstruction and to feel more free. Minimalistic design emphasizes calm, so large windows bring natural light in.
